发明名称 ELECTRIC AUTOMOBILE BRAKING DEVICE
摘要 PURPOSE: To improve the recovery percentage of braking energy and the feeling of a brake pedal by finding the decelerated result of a drive wheel based on the detected rotating speed of the drive wheel and deciding the decreasing amount of the regenerative braking force in accordance with the found deceleration. CONSTITUTION: When a vehicle is not stopped and a brake switch 20 is turned on, an ECU 16 calculates a regenerative torque commanding value based on the pressure of a master cylinder(MC) or wheel cylinder(WC). The calculated commanding value is used for the control of an inverter 12 after the value is corrected to a smaller value. At the time of correcting the commanding value, a car body speed sensor 44 detects the car body speed V of the vehicle and a wheel speed sensor 42 detects the wheel speed Vωof a drive wheel and an ECU 16 reads the detected speeds. At the time of reading the speeds, the ECU 16 calculates the difference between the speeds. Then the ECU 16 finds the differentiated value of the wheel speed Vωnamely, the deceleration of the drive wheel. Thereafter, the ECU 16 calculates the decreasing amount of the regenerative torque commanding value by utilizing the values thus found. Therefore, the drive wheel is released from a locked state.
